The Research On The TCP Message Reverting And Application In The Broadband Network

Nowadays network communication is developing toward the broadband, which causes the increase of network data throughput. This increase brings much more valuable information and requires stronger protection of network security. Now many of the domestic or foreign network security products are faced to low-speed user network, which can only deal with the data speed below 100Mbps and can not cope with the networks with higher and higher speed.Based on the research of reverting and analyzing TCP message technology, a system is designed and realized in this paper to revert and analyze TCP message in real time. A series of works are accomplished in the system, including incepting data, analyzing IP package in real time, reverting TCP message in real time, analyzing main protocols on application layer and data filter. Because the broadband data has high speed so that it needs strong capability of data disposal. In this paper three key points are emphasized to optimize design in order that the system can work above the speed of 300Mbps.1) The suitable design of high speed package catching interface. In this paper the ZERO-COPY-SNIFF is realized in 600Mbps and WinPcap in 300Mbps.Through capability testing, the quantitative analysis of the package catching speed and the CPU occupancy for the two way of package catching are also achieved.2) The suitable algorithm to manage complex links and to search links quickly. There are three different ways of HASH algorithm compared in this paper to prove that CRC32 is the fittest one for the throughput speed above 300Mbps.3) Memory management. Optimized design of memory management is adopted to insure high-speed data cache. The relations between memory assignment and various kinds of IP packages are discussed using Queue theory.
